Hi there,

I have a grid within some outer border layout with the following properties:

xtype: 'grid',
store: 'MyStore',
loadMask: true,
viewConfig: {forceFit: true},
region: 'center',
Within the grid, I have several columns with properties like that:

xtype: 'gridcolumn',
dataIndex: 'month',
header: 'Month',
sortable: true,
width: 100
I autoload the store which results in more lines than are visible.

What happens now, is that the grid expands correctly within the panel and all columns adapt their size - but then the vertical scroll bar overlays the last column:
Since the rendering is slow, I can see that first the grid is displayed and then after the lines are filled in, the scrollbar appears.

Now, when I resize the panel with the split button, it displays the grid and scrollbar correctly.

Any idea why that happens and how to get it right when opening the view?


Are you sure the total width of your columns isin't bigger than the grid width itself? The problems goes away if you reduce your column widths?

Oh man - it was in deed such simple!
I thought they would resize in case it's too much and I was distracted by another view which seemed right despite having the same column sizes.

Thanks, Geziefer